Web页面美化大师:CSS基础与高级技巧解析
![](https://csdnimg.cn/release/wenkucmsfe/public/img/starY.0159711c.png)
"Web实用网页设计方法css-4之一:该资源详细介绍了CSS(层叠样式表)的基础和高级设计方法,适合初学者学习。通过学习,可以掌握CSS的相关概念、设置方式、基本语法、样式属性以及框模型。"
在Web开发领域,CSS(Cascading Style Sheets)是一种强大的技术,用于定义网页的布局和视觉样式。它让开发者能够将内容的结构和展示分离,从而提高网页的可读性和维护性。CSS是与HTML和JavaScript并列的三种主要Web开发技术之一。
CSS的目标是提供一种外观控制机制,解决HTML原本只能定义文档内容而无法有效控制布局的问题。随着网站设计需求的复杂化,HTML规范引入了新的标签和属性,但CSS的出现使得开发者能够更加灵活地控制页面样式,无需依赖过多的格式化HTML标签。
CSS的基本概念包括其语法结构,它允许对网页中的任何元素进行样式定义,并且一个样式可以应用于多个页面,实现样式的一致性。这使得全局更新样式变得简单,提高了工作效率。
在实际应用中,CSS可以通过多种方式设置,包括内联样式(直接在HTML元素中使用`style`属性)、内部样式表(在`<head>`部分的`<style>`标签内定义)和外部样式表(链接到单独的`.css`文件)。这种层叠特性使得样式优先级得以管理,方便覆盖和继承。
CSS的基本语法包括选择器(用于指定要应用样式的元素)和声明块(包含属性和值)。例如,以下代码示例展示了如何使用CSS设置文本颜色和字体:
```css
h3 {
font-family: Helvetica;
color: red;
}
```
此代码将所有`<h3>`标题的字体设置为Helvetica,文字颜色设为红色。CSS还包含许多其他样式属性,如边距、填充、边框等,这些组合在一起构成了CSS的框模型,用于控制元素的尺寸和位置。
通过学习这个资源,初学者将能够理解CSS的核心概念,学会如何编写和应用CSS规则,以及掌握CSS在网页设计中的重要性和实用性。结合实际的项目练习,这些知识将帮助开发者创建出美观、响应式且易于维护的网页。
18778 浏览量
780 浏览量
184 浏览量
454 浏览量
2024-12-27 上传
134 浏览量
2025-01-07 上传
528 浏览量
173 浏览量
![](https://profile-avatar.csdnimg.cn/default.jpg!1)
neusoftwcr
- 粉丝: 0
最新资源
- Python分类MNIST数据集的简单实现
- Laravel框架实战开发项目:Eval-App
- 通用触屏驱动:四点或九点校正功能
- 自定义相机应用:拍照、水印添加及屏幕适应预览
- 微信多开协议二次开发及MYSQL数据库配置指南
- 探索Googology网站:yaxtzee.github.io的深度解析
- React组件开发教程与实践指南
- 掌握OpenGL+Qt模拟聚光灯效果
- xlrd-0.9.3:Python处理Excel的强大库
- ycu校园网站前端开发教程与实践
- I2S接口APB总线代码与文档解析
- 基于MATLAB的陀螺仪数据卡尔曼滤波处理
- 答题APP代码实现:MySQL+JSP+Android整合
- 牛津AI小组与微软合作实现Project 15音频识别挑战
- 实现QQ风格侧滑删除功能的SwipeDemo教程
- MATLAB中Log-Likelihood函数的开发与应用